RiverWinds Course
West Deptford, NJ, USA



RiverWinds Golf Club, a public course set against the Delaware River in West Deptford, NJ, offers sweeping vistas that belie its relative youth. While not steeped in century-old traditions, RiverWinds presents a contemporary golfing experience sculpted within the region's unique landscape. Designed by an unknown architect, the course exhibits modern characteristics, featuring generous fairways and strategically placed water hazards that come into play on several holes. The bentgrass fairways are a delight. The greens complexes are known for subtle undulations, rewarding thoughtful approach shots over raw power. While not overly penal from the tee, RiverWinds demands strategic placement to navigate doglegs and avoid riverside breezes that can significantly influence club selection. RiverWinds, while not hosting major championships, serves as a popular destination for local tournaments and everyday play, known for the camaraderie of its regular players. Many members enjoy a quick post round bite at the club's restaurant or bar. It's a valued community asset, offering accessible golf in a scenic setting.

Golfers say this course offers some appealing links-style play with notable Philly skyline views, though most find the overall experience falls short of expectations. Reviewers consistently cite slow pace as a major drawback, with rounds taking considerably longer than desired, particularly during peak season. The facility receives criticism for its lack of amenities—no driving range, no walking allowed, challenging parking, and an unusually long trek from clubhouse to first tee. While some appreciate the layout and scenic backdrop including views of the airport and stadium, many feel the course is overrated and overpriced for what amounts to a typical public-course experience with frustrating operational issues.
